本文围绕“TP 安卓(以 TokenPocket 类原生 Web3 钱包为代表)从兑换(Swap/兑换操作)到选择钱包页面的完整路径与实现要点”展开全面分析,并在此基础上探讨全球化支付解决方案、信息化科技平台、专家洞悉、智能化数据创新、网页钱包与代币分配的关键考量。
一、功能流程拆解(用户路径)
1) 发起兑换:用户在 DApp 浏览器或内嵌 Swap 页面选择交易对/数量,系统通过前端 SDK 调用路由器(如 1inch、Uniswap 路由)构建交易数据。
2) 预估并确认:展示滑点、预计手续费(gas)、路由详情;用户确认后,产生待签名交易数据(rawTx)。

3) 选择签名钱包:若设备存在多账号或多钱包实现(例如多助记词子账户、硬件钱包、网页钱包),需要跳转或弹出“选择钱包/账户”页面供用户选择签名者。
4) 签名与广播:选定账户后,调用本地密钥管理模块或 WalletConnect、外部签名设备完成签名并将交易发送到 RPC 节点。
5) 交易回执与到账:监听链上回执,展示成功/失败状态并在必要时引导用户添加代币到资产列表。
二、关键技术要点
- 链接方式:支持内置 WebView 原生 bridge、WalletConnect v1/v2、深度链接(custom URI)以便网页与本地钱包无缝交互。
- 权限与安全:交易数据需二次确认,最小权限授权、Allowlist、nonce 管理和重放防护。
- 多账户管理:账户元数据、别名、图标、地址簿;切换应低延迟且保持签名上下文一致。
- UX:在兑换确认与钱包选择间保持连续性(动画/返回栈)、预填充 gas 与滑点提示、可回滚的撤销/取消操作。
- 异常处理:签名取消、链上失败、钱包离线、网络更换提示与自动回退逻辑。

三、全球化支付与网页钱包的衔接
- 法币入金/出金:集成合规的 Fiat On/Off Ramp(Ramp、MoonPay、Simplex),支持多币种、KYC 流程与区域限额。
- 多网络与跨链桥:支持 EVM、Solana、Cosmos 等主网,提供跨链路由并在兑换后提示目标链接收钱包或 token wrapping。
- 本地化与合规:税务、制裁名单、国家性支付规范与用户身份验证流程的无缝嵌入。
四、信息化科技平台与智能化数据创新
- 平台架构:采取微服务、可观测性(日志、链上事件流)、分布式缓存与队列(Kafka/RabbitMQ)以支撑高并发交易请求。
- 智能路由与定价:利用链上/链下市场深度数据和 ML 模型进行最优路由、滑点最小化与前置防护(MEV 避免策略)。
- 风控与反欺诈:实时行为分析、异常交易识别、黑名单/风险评分与自动风控规则。
五、专家洞悉与落地建议
- 标准化交互:优先采用 WalletConnect V2 + EIP-1193 等标准,降低 Web 与原生互操作成本。
- 可组合性:将兑换模块、签名模块、钱包选择模块设计为独立可复用组件,便于 AB 测试与快速迭代。
- 隐私与 UX 平衡:尽量在本地完成敏感操作,减少链外隐私泄露,同时给出清晰的用户可理解提示。
六、代币分配与治理考量
- 分配策略:明确团队/社区/生态/储备的比例与锁仓(vesting)机制,使用多签和时间锁保障资金安全。
- 空投与领取流程:在兑换页或资产页加入自动分发/Claim 流程,并通过网页钱包兼容签名降低门槛。
七、实施清单(工程与产品)
- 集成:Web3 bridge、WalletConnect、Fiat On/Off SDK、RPC 池与路由器。
- 测试:链上回放测试、不同网络与延迟下的 UX 测试、故障注入演练。
- 监控:交易成功率、签名失败率、用户切换钱包频率、跨境合规指标。
结论:从兑换到选择钱包页面看似简单的跳转,实则涉及链内外多层协同——前端交互、签名桥接、网络路由、合规与风控、以及智能化数据支持。采用标准化互操作协议、模块化架构与智能风控,可以在全球化支付与网页钱包场景下实现既安全又流畅的用户体验,同时为代币分配与治理留出可审计、可回溯的技术通路。
评论
Sunny88
对工程实现拆解很到位,WalletConnect 的建议尤其实用。
小白测试
看完后对 TP 安卓的流程有更清晰的理解,代币分配那段很重要。
CryptoFan
建议补充一些具体的异常场景示例和应急流程,比如签名超时处理。
李阿木
关于法币通道和合规的部分帮忙解决了很多实际问题,感谢分享。